SITUATION

The land occupies a strategic semi-rural position close to the development boundary of Salisbury City, a principal settlement within southern Wiltshire.

Access is directly off the A360 Devizes Road, an arterial route linking Salisbury to the A303, across Salisbury Plain to Devizes.

The whole of the land falls within the Stratford sub Castle Conservation Area.

A location plan is provided within these particulars.

DESCRIPTION

About 42.08 acres (17.03 hectares) of gently sloping grassland in a compact block. The underlying soil is classified as Grade III and soil association Andover 1 – a shallow well-drained calcareous silty soil over chalk.

The land faces east, rising about 50 metres in elevation from the flood plains of the River Avon up to the A360, with views overlooking the Woodford Valley (north) and Old Sarum (east).

A public footpath runs along (outside) the eastern boundary of the land, which follows the River Avon back to Salisbury through the Avon Valley Nature Reserve and the Salisbury River Park.

OVERAGE/DEVELOPMENT UPLIFT

It is proposed the land will be sold subject to a development uplift clause which will run for 30 years. This clause will reserve to the seller 25% of any increase in the value of the land arising from the grant of planning permission for non-agricultural or equestrian development.

ANTI-MONEY LAUNDERING

Woolley & Wallis are legally required to conduct Anti-Money Laundering (AML) checks on all parties involved in the sale or purchase of a property. Woolley & Wallis use a specialist service called "Guild 365" to perform these checks. This is a service offered to Agents who are members of the Guild of Property Professionals. These checks must be completed before a property is listed for sale and as soon as an offer is accepted (before we send out the Memorandum of Sale). There is a non-refundable fee of £25 + VAT per person. Note: Woolley & Wallis receive a portion of this fee to cover our administration costs in processing these legal checks.
